The client is currently recruiting for the position of Senior Control and Instrumentation Engineer, based in Aberdeen.

Responsibilities:
* Ensure Technical competence of Control & Instrumentation Maintenance delivery personnel, interviewing and testing competency.
* Ensure that discipline specific engineering work (OPEX) remains within budget.
* Ensure delivery of a technically correct and timely engineering work (OPEX) service.
* Provide optimised preventative maintenance programmes for Control & Instrumentation equipment and implementing industry best practice.
* Engage and participate in any operational improvement process to optimise discipline specific engineering (OPEX) support.
* Provide discipline input to the 28- and 90-day asset planning process.
* Provide discipline guidance and engineering endorsement to proposed changes to PMRs within the SAP CMMS.
* Represent the company as technical representative for asset support contracts.
* Act as liaison with other disciplines, vendor representatives, and manufacturers.
* Ensure vendors are mobilised on time to meet the asset planning schedule and that vendors mobilise fully prepared to execute scopes of work on time and within agreed budget.
* Assist with the resolution of operational problems, including participation in and close-out of accident/incident investigations and root cause analysis.
* Complete assigned actions e.g., ICP, MyHSES etc. by their set due date.
* Provide engineering advice and endorsement of engineering change (MOC), maintenance deferrals, ORA's, etc as per the authorisation levels dictated by the company's engineering standards.
* Responsible for equipment performance including spare part management and warranty follow-up.
* Ensure performance standards are accurate and adhered to via the Inspection, Test and Maintenance programme.
* Actively engage with the site execution teams, ensuring participation in corporate behavioural safety and intervention schemes, work to enhance communication and promote understanding of goals.
